How to Change the geoip database on-premise in a clustered environment?

I read from https://docs.splunk.com/Documentation/Splunk/9.0.4/SearchReference/Iplocation : 

 

 

The iplocation command is a distributable streaming command, which means that it can be processed on the indexers. 

 

 

My goal is to sync out a  fetched database from maxmind (GeoLite2-City edition) twice per week to ~/share/GeoLite2-City-custom.mmdb and set this in ~/etc/system/local/limits.conf:

 

 

[iplocation]
db_path = /opt/splunk/share/GeoLite2-custom.mmdb

 

 

My main concern is how to deal with this later, when our sync script fetches a new database and syncs it to the SHC/IDXC. For instance, we have a savedsearch scheduled with cron_schedule = */1 * * * * (Run every minute) that utilizes the iplocation command. We might encounter an issue where the search is run during those seconds the file is being transferred. 

Any recommendations on how to deal with this? Any way to have the scheduled search run every minute of every day except on Wednesdays and Saturdays between 03:05 and 03:10?
